Yeah, I've been pretty excited about playing this, but I'm definitely *not* a fan of revealing both decklists.
From a play experience perspective, I feel the cons far outweigh the pros.

Keeping decklists obscured allows you to sneak in one-ofs for the surprise factor or other tech. If both decks are a known constant from the very beginning, then players will probably be able to tell which list will win (assuming equal skill levels). When both decks are an unknown, you're forced to play differently because you're playing around uncertainties--decklists eliminates that entirely.

It's even worse in draft. No one wants to play a game they're goingt to lose, and if you see your deck is outclassed from the get-go, it's just going to be a negative experience. This will probably just encourage people to concede in casual, or become super salty in constructed.

I don't understand the reasoning behind its inclusion. What a mind boggler.
